Why it is dangerous to light a Bunsen burner with the air hole open?

Opening the air hole on a Bunsen burner before lighting it can create a flammable gas-air mixture that is highly explosive. This increases the risk of a flashback when the flame ignites, which can cause a sudden, intense flare-up and potential injury. It is important to always light a Bunsen burner with the air hole closed to prevent this dangerous situation.


Why does opening the air hole in a Bunsen burner make the flame hotter?

Opening the air hole in a Bunsen burner allows more air to mix with the gas before combustion, creating a more efficient and hotter flame. This increased supply of oxygen enhances the combustion process, resulting in a higher temperature flame.
